Synopsis
The "Ultimate Guide to Crown Molding" shows readers how they can add style and originality to their homes just by installing crown molding. With over 350 photographs, author Neal Barrett takes readers through the process of selecting crown molding designs for their homes, choosing the right materials, and mastering the techniques of cutting and installing the trim work. But the heart of the book is the 30 crown-molding projects. Each contains detailed step-by-step photographs and clear concise text that show how each unique design is created. An extensive resource guide is provided for locating unusual tools and materials, along with a comprehensive index and glossary to cover the whole spectrum of the crown molding process. This approach gives even the novice do-it-yourselfer the confidence to tackle the projects.
